On 7/13/2022 10:58 PM, Henning Hraban Ramm via ntg-context wrote:
> Am 13.07.22 um 22:33 schrieb Hans Hagen via ntg-context:
>> in mlib-int.lmt change this:
>>
>> registerdirect("PageNumber",           function() return 
>> getcount("userpageno")                    end)
>>
>> (beware it's there twice - i'll fix that)
>>
>> btw, normally you would use RealPageNumber for such a counter
> 
> Thank you, I just replaced all occurrences of PageNumber with 
> RealPageNumber, and it works.
> This seems to have changed within the last few years, though.
Not really ... what did change was the gleu between tex - lua - mp (way 
more efficient and direct) and 'pageno' is some old plain thing, we have 
userpageno ... so user interface wise it's all the same (maybe some more 
actuall).  What did change was the adapation to even /odd pages for 
which one had to do some swapping in the mp code and which is now more 
automatic
